Expected behavior
Once I boot the app, I can set an environment variable that prevents ForestAdmin from generating schema changes.
I'm currently using
export FOREST_DISABLE_AUTO_SCHEMA_APPLY=truebut this does not prevent ForestAdmin schema from generating.
Actual behavior
Once I boot the app, the ForestAdmin schema generator starts running, and if my schema is out of date it creates some unstaged changes in git. I can't figure out how to get it to stop generating changes, even when I close my app.
This is particularly annoying because it generates changes every time I switch branches, and then blocks me from switching again until I clear the changes that are generated.
e.g.
git checkout maingit checkout some-other-branch- Oh no! I ForestAdmin just generated some changes and I can't switch branches!
git reset --hard origin/maingit checkout some-other-branch(again)git checkout some-other-other-branch- Oh no! I ForestAdmin just generated some changes and I can't switch branches!
git reset --hard origin/some-other-other-branchgit checkout some-other-other-branch(again)
